Copper: The Silent Engine of AI and Energy

Copper’s not just old-school—it’s the silent engine powering AI, electric cars, and modern grids. Demand could soar from 34 million to over 42 million metric tons by 2035, fueled by tech, EVs, infrastructure, and defense. Known as “Dr. Copper,” its price often mirrors economic health. Chile leads production, with China dominating smelting, but mining’s environmental toll and long development cycles (up to 17 years) add risk.
